How Cicero and Clay’s trash hauler dug itself out after falling behind with garbage...
Joe Buffa says it was the perfect storm of trash, snow and sickness -- and one that left garbage cans and piles on curbs for too long in Clay and Cicero last week. “Anything that could go wrong went wrong all at once,” said Buffa, who runs Superior Waste Removal in Warners and picks up waste in Clay and Cicero.

Man stabbed to death in Salina was killed by his brother-in-law, prosecutor says
Salina, N.Y. — A man who was fatally stabbed in Salina on Friday was killed by his brother-in-law, prosecutors said. Taiwo Ogunsola, 38, of Salina, was stabbed multiple times in the neck with a kitchen knife Friday afternoon by Raoof Mustafa, 47, according to a criminal complaint.
